<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;"><span style="font-family: Calibri; font-size: small;">Later that day, the Inaugural Ball was held at Founders Hall, a venue which was quickly determined to be undersized for the number of people who responded to the invitation.  We came to their aid by providing a climate-controlled tent with connecting marquee to handle an additional capacity of 500 guests at the front entrance of the hall.  The installation took a non-stop 36 hours to install, including flooring, carpet, heat and lighting. </span></p>

<p><strong>You researched the possible sites in <a title="click here if you have not read part 1 yet" href="http://www.eventcentralpa.com/blog/2009/10/selecting-an-outdoor-wedding-reception-site-part-i/">Part I<br />
</a></strong>You found some great options.  You  might even have checked some references ahead of time.  The appointments are made, and you are on your way!   You would hate to arrive to find they are tied up with another client or a wedding.  What&#8217;s next-</p>
<p><strong>Site selection visits - what to bring</strong><br />
Bring along your list of questions and a camera or video recorder to document the site. This will come in handy when it comes to decision time, especially if others participating in the decision are unable to accompany you.  Consider asking your family member to take notes so you can concentrate on what you are being shown.</p>
<div id="attachment_725" class="wp-caption alignnone" style="width: 499px">
	<a title="The pictures in this colage are of the Conawago Inn with a 50x100 installed by Event Central" href="http://www.conewagomanorinn.com/"><img class="size-full wp-image-725 " title="The 2 pictures shown are taken at The Conawago Manor Inn with the 50 x 100 tent installed on the lower brick patio by Event Central" src="http://www.eventcentralpa.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2009/04/camera.jpg" alt="Camera        Pen &amp; Paper       Son't Forget Dad's Tape Measure" width="499" height="413" /></a>
	<p class="wp-caption-text">Camera  Pen &amp; Paper  and Don&#39;t Forget Dad&#39;s Tape Measure</p>
</div>
<p><strong>What is included/excluded<br />
</strong>An important objective of the appointment is determining what is included in the price quote, e.g. tables and chairs. If a specific amount of time is allotted, are there possible overtime charges? Do they provide catering, require that you use an approved caterer, or can you bring in your own caterer? Moreover, if you want to have the ceremony on-site, verify that is possible and the added costs. Will yours be the only wedding that day or will other events go on simultaneously?</p>
<p><strong>Will you need a Rental Service</strong><br />
For your Party Rental company to do a great job for you, they could need between 1 or 2 days to set up, depending on the number of tents, and their complexity.  It is always in your best interest if they can move up a day to avoid a soaking rain. Similarly, in a perfect world, tents should come down the next dry day, to increase the opportunity to keep your tent clean and dry. (Just like the setup when your tent was used at a previous wedding.)</p>
<p><strong>Covering all the bases<br />
</strong>Tour the site to look for adequate guest parking, bride and groom changing areas, restroom facilities and wheelchair accessibility. Inquire during the meeting about liability insurance, music restrictions, access for taking pictures and whether setup and cleanup times are included in the allotted time on the contract.</p>

<p><strong>Discount incentives and determining the total cost<br />
</strong>If you want to consider a Sunday, mid-week or off-season wedding, ask if there are discounts at those periods. Be sure to understand the payment schedule, and if there are any hidden or extra charges that are not listed in any of the contracts. Before leaving, request an event packet that will include costs, contracts, rules and regulations.</p>
<div class="mceTemp"><strong>This contract stuff is important<br />
</strong>Signing a site contract means that you’ve agreed to all the rules and conditions stipulated by the site. Make sure all specific details for your reception are written into the contracts before you sign. If it isn’t specifically addressed in writing, you can’t expect it to be covered.  If there is a service that you requested  that is outside of their normal service/contract,  jot it down on a separate sheet of paper entitled &#8220;Addendum to our Agreement&#8221;,  and have all parties sign it.  Chances are the person signing the contract is passing all this on to someone else who was not party to your discussions.  Now you have a scope of work everyone agreed upon.</div>

<p><strong>Write down your impressions</strong><br />
The Site Staff are key people in your decision.  Did they impress you with their ideas, friendliness, the handling of your questions?    Were they interested in putting you first  to create special memories that will last your lifetime.  The event staff should be fun to do business with at a well run venue.</p>
<p>If something does not feel right about the people or the site, give your self time to think about it.  Don&#8217;t be rushed.  Wait till you have visited all the sites prior to making a final decision.</p>
<p><strong>Finalizing your decision<br />
</strong>After you have visited all the sites,  the best site may already be obvious.  If it is still up in the air, sit down soon and write a list of the Pros and Cons of each site.  Study the answers provided to your prepared questions, and compare one site with the other.  When you decision is made, review contracts carefully to be sure you understand the language before signing on the dotted line. Most deposits are non-refundable and non-transferable.  Should you decide to move your wedding date, facilities generally will not transfer the deposit to that date, so pay close attention to disclaimers, deposit requirements and payment schedules.</p>

<p><span style="color:#ff0000;"><span style="color:#000000;"><strong>What are you looking for as a reception site?<br />
</strong></span></span><span style="color:#ff0000;"><span style="color:#000000;">Make a written list of questions that are important to you, such as:<br />
~</span></span><span style="color:#000000;">Where is the location in relation to your ceremony site, your guests,  and area hotels?<br />
~</span><span style="color:#000000;">What is your estimated guest count in contrast to their capacity?<br />
</span><span style="color:#000000;">~</span><span style="color:#000000;">Estimate  your budget for the reception site (this us usually tied to the catering budget).<br />
</span><span style="color:#000000;">~Will you be confined to their in-house caterer list, or can you select the caterer of your choice?<br />
~</span><span style="color:#000000;">Other concerns such as policies of the property ie. alcohol or food handling, changing rooms, guest facilities, parking distance and lighting at night may also be pertinent.<br />
~</span><span style="color:#000000;">Do they have a good reputation within the wedding industry?<br />
~</span><span style="color:#000000;">Are they willing to provide references? </span></p>
<p><span style="color:#000000;">If your time is precious the best rule of thumb is<br />
“<em>Don&#8217;t waste a trip to see the location if it cannot meet the basic criteria.</em><strong>”</strong></span></p>

<p><span style="color:#000000;"><strong>Where to Search for a Wedding R</strong></span><span style="color:#000000;"><strong>eception Site<br />
~</strong></span><span style="color:#000000;">Local and On Line Wedding Publications<br />
~</span><span style="color:#000000;">Yellow Pages<br />
~</span><span style="color:#000000;">Party Rental Stores<br />
~</span><span style="color:#000000;">Local Bridal Shows<br />
~</span><span style="color:#000000;">On-line Wedding Internet Sites<br />
~</span><span style="color:#000000;">Ask friends about sites they think will appeal to you.</span></p>
<p><span style="color:#000000;"><strong>Call the sites of interest </strong>once you&#8217;ve identified a manageable list.  Run through your selection criteria while on the phone.  If they won&#8217;t take the time over the phone to discuss the site with you, they may be wasting your time and theirs during a personal visit. if the site does not meet your budget, for example. </span></p>
<p><span style="color:#000000;"><strong>Summarizing<br />
</strong></span><span style="color:#000000;">Ok, you know what you want. You found 3 sites that fit the criteria, now it&#8217;s time to visit them.  This is when it is important to engage a parent and perhaps your fiance&#8217;.  Make an appointment for a specific day and time.  Obtain contact name(s) when setting up your appointments and plan, at a minimum, thirty to forty minutes at each facility you will visit.   Then draft a list of questions pertinent to your reception requirements. If there are questions unique to one site but  not another,  write it down. </span></p>

<p class="wp-caption-text"><a href="http://edsskiandcycle.com">Ed&#8217;s Ski &amp; Cycle</a> of York closed last Spring, leaving a gracious farewell on their Web site.  (Note as of 1/10/10 web site was taken down STW)</p>
<p class="wp-caption-text">If you take a moment to read their farewell, it illustrates how local sports specialty shop has a hard time competing the big box stores, with their seeming deep discounts. Unfortunately for the consumer, and especially a ski and boarding customer, the noise big chains create from saturation advertising is less likely to result in a positive experience for the customer, as they rarely are organized or equipped with the technical training, expertise and years of experience that local ski shops offer.  An inaccurately adjusted binding, an incorrectly specified ski length or a poorly fitted boot can put skiers and boarders at higher risk of injury, all in the name of saving a few percent of the customer&#8217;s purchase price.</p>
<p class="wp-caption-text">My brother and I have skied for over 50 years each.  And for several years, I have been a senior member of the <span id="lw_1254150315_11" class="yshortcuts" style="border-bottom: #0066cc 1px dashed; cursor: pointer;">National Ski Patrol</span>, spending winters slope-side with skiers of all levels.  We and other experienced skiers know you cannot place a dollar value on the service your local ski shop offers.  Local operations are staffed with enthusiasts well equipped to match your needs accurately to the right gear. Moreover, they tend to keep up on the technical training needed to properly serve the local store&#8217;s customers base.</p>
<p class="wp-caption-text">More than once, I have been waited on by seasonal college students at local stores and watched as the business owners were always there to step in to help when called for. Customers who comparison shop find the local shop can typically compete well on price, but it&#8217;s superior service that distinguishes them, helping customers toward a more rewarding and arguably safer skiing experience.</p>
